Operation
These DC coil kits have separate pickup and seal windings. A special (side
mounted) early-break NCI auxiliary
contact is used to either disconnect the
pick-up winding or insert the seal
winding in series with the pick-up
winding, depending on the frame size
of the contactor. DC coil kits come in
two styles, a suffix 1 and a suffix 4. The
1 suffix contains only the special (side
mounted) early break NCI auxiliary
contact. The 4 suffix contains a NO
contact in the same package as the
special (side mounted) early-break NCI
auxiliary contact.
Note: For NEMA Sizes 00 and 0 contactors
may utilize either suffix 1 or 4 DC coil kits;
starters may utilize suffix 4 DC coil kits only.
For NEMA Sizes 1 and 2, both contactors
and starters may utilize a suffix 4 DC coil
kit only.
On the above sizes only, when the
special auxiliary package is mounted
on the side of a contactor or starter,
no standard auxiliary contact may be
mounted on the same side.
Note: For NEMA Sizes 3 – 5, the special coil
NCI clearing contact is an add-on auxiliary
(must mount on a base mount auxiliary
contact; normally a 1NO). This arrangement
will normally account for two of the three
contact positions on the side of each contactor or starter.

The Advantage Metering Module monitors status of a motor along with any
of the pushbutton modules. It may be
plugged into the pushbutton control
module, and communicates to the
starter through it, or plugged directly
into the starter when a pushbutton
control module is not used.
The four digit display will show the
current in each phase, control voltage
or cause of trip. The STEP button may
be pressed to step through these values, and the five LEDs will indicate
which value is being displayed. It is
also equipped with a reset button and
Trip Lockout LED.

Heater Selection
General Information on Heater Coil Selection
For maximum motor protection and compliance with Article
430-32 of the National Electrical Code, select heater coils
from the tables in this section on the basis of motor nameplate full load current.
When the full load current is unknown, selection may be
made on the basis of average full load currents.
Caution — The average ratings could be high or low for a
specific motor and therefore selection on this basis always
involves risk. For fully reliable motor protection, select
heater coils on the basis of full load current rating as shown
on the motor nameplate.
Heater coils are rated to protect 40°C rise motors, and
open and drip-proof motors having a service factor of 1.15
where the motor and the controller are at the same ambient
temperature.
16
For other conditions:
16
1. For 50°C, 55°C, 75°C rise motors and enclosed motors
having a service factor of 1.0, select one size smaller
coil.
2. Ambient temperature of controller lower than motor by
26°C (47°F), use one size smaller coil.
3. Ambient temperature of controller higher than motor by
26°C (47°F), use one size larger coil.
Ultimate tripping current of heater coils is approximately
1.25 times the minimum current rating listed in the tables.

Overload Protection Size 5 Starters
Type B overload relay is a three-pole, block type, thermal
ambient compensated device with manual reset mounted
integrally. Current transformers are enclosed in a protective
case and integrally mounted to save panel space. Standard
ratio is 300:5.
Overload Protection Size 6 Starters
Overload protection assembly consists of three current
transformers, Type B three-pole block overload relay and an
optional interposing relay. These parts are mounted on a
panel which connects directly to the load terminal of the
contactor. Current transformers are 600:5 ratio as standard.
If automatic reset is required, the Type A, three-pole block,
ambient compensated relay is available upon request.

Auxiliary Contacts for CN35/ECL
CN35 Lighting Contactors include a
1NO maintaining auxiliary contact
mounted on right hand side (on 10A,
2- and 3-pole devices, auxiliary contact
occupies 4th power pole position — no
increase in width). The 10 – 60A
devices will accept additional auxiliary
contacts on the top and/or sides.
Auxiliary contact blocks are designed
for snap-on installation — fast, easy
installation (no tools required up to
60A). All auxiliary contacts are of the
bifurcated design with parallel circuit
paths. This redundant path provides
very high reliability. Auxiliary contacts
can be snapped on the side (up to 2
circuits — per auxiliary contact) and on
the top (up to 4 circuits). Auxiliary contacts for larger contactors, 100 – 400A
sizes, will accept side mounted auxiliaries only and easily attach to the side
of the contactor with 2 screws.
